The L.U.C XPS 1860 Officer Madrid Edition
This is a limited edition of 7 pieces with a burgundy dial made for the Chopard Boutique in Madrid, Spain.
I have previously listed all
Chopard's officer caseback watches, including all XPS 1860 Officer variants, and, like the
Hodinkee Edition or the
2021 Vendôme One, this Madrid Edition has a
double index at twelve o'clock instead of an
Arabic 12.

The
inner side of the hinged caseback is
engraved with the
coats of arms of the city.
They date back to the 12th century and depict a brown bear with a strawberry tree, one of the legends suggesting that the city's original name was Ursaria (Latin for "land of bears," due to their large presence in the surrounding forests).
The seven stars surrounding the bear symbolize the Great Bear constellation.
And the crown, the last element added to the coats of arms in 1544, is the symbol of the monarchy.
Finally, the blason underneath bears the motto De Madrid al Cielo , meaning From Madrid to the sky, which is probably to be understood as "there is no place like Madrid".
